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Apple Capsid | Moluccan Flying Fox |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Hemiptera (Hemiptera)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Miridae |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) |
| Genus | Lygocoris | Pteropus (Flying Foxes) |
| Species | Lygocoris rugicollis | Pteropus chrysoproctus |
